Fascism expert flees US for Spain after receiving death threats
Mark Bray, a history professor at Rutgers University and antifascism expert, has left the United States and sought refuge in Spain with his family due to death threats and harassment from conservative groups. Though he denies membership in Antifa, his academic work has made him a target following Donald Trump's designation of the group as terrorist. Bray now lives in Madrid and has moved his classes online for safety reasons.

Attorney general testifies in Supreme Court over Ayuso partner email leak
Sabtu, 11 Oktober 2025 Gambar dihasilkan oleh AI
Attorney General Álvaro García Ortiz denied before Judge Ángel Hurtado leaking a confidential email from Isabel Díaz Ayuso's partner in a tax fraud case. Alberto González Amador and Miguel Ángel Rodríguez also testified, revealing details on authorizations and hoaxes in the proceedings. The statements highlight tensions in the Prosecutor's Office and prior leaks in the case.

Chaotic congress session approves sustainable mobility law
Spain's Congress experienced a tense session on October 8, 2025, with a PP deputy's honeymoon absence and a last-minute deal with Podemos enabling the sustainable mobility law's approval. The vote, fraught with errors and rumors, ended with 174 votes in favor after Podemos abstained. Transport Minister Óscar Puente confirmed the eleventh-hour agreement.

Ángel Ayora leads Spaniards in second round of Open de España
Sabtu, 11 Oktober 2025 Dilaporkan oleh AI
Young Málaga golfer Ángel Ayora emerged as the top Spaniard with -6 after the second round of the Open de España, three shots behind leader Marco Penge of England. Jon Rahm mounted a comeback with a solid -5 round to reach -4 overall, though he regretted misses on short putts. Other Spaniards like David Puig and Rafa Cabrera-Bello also progressed in the standings.
